The role

Summary

Airwallex is seeking an experienced Engineering Manager to lead a groundbreaking Infrastructure Automation team in Seattle. This role focuses on developing AI-powered agents to automate DevOps, SRE, and database operations, leveraging cutting-edge technologies to reduce operational toil and improve system reliability across a global engineering organization.

What you'll do

Team Leadership: Build and lead the Infrastructure Automation team, hiring and developing 5 engineers (3 SWE/DevOps + 2 DBA/SWE). Establish team processes, culture, and create an environment for high-performance engineering.
AI Automation Strategy: Define and execute the technical vision for AI-powered infrastructure agents, identifying and prioritizing high-impact automation opportunities across DevOps, SRE, and DBA operations.
DevOps and SRE Automation: Lead the design and development of intelligent agents for autonomous incident response, root cause analysis, infrastructure provisioning, and change management.
Database Automation: Drive development of AI agents for database operations, including schema migration validation, query performance analysis, capacity forecasting, and self-healing replication management.
Reliability and Excellence: Ensure automation systems are production-grade, reliable, and well-monitored. Participate in on-call rotations, lead postmortems, and enforce quality standards.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with Cloud Infrastructure, SRE, DBA, Observability, and Productivity teams to identify automation targets, integrate systems, and drive adoption of AI-powered tooling.
